Here’s a set of images of a modified Ford Endeavour, which is loaded with a lot of aftermarket equipment. The list also includes adjustable suspension.

Ford Endeavour is one of the most capable SUVs in its segment. In the Indian market, it competes against the likes of MG Gloster and Toyota Fortuner. It is popular among buyers for its massive dimensions, feature-loaded cabin and all-terrain capabilities. To enhance the off-road capabilities of the SUV and make it look more rugged, enthusiasts around India customize it as per their preference. Here’s are a few images of a Ford Endeavour, which has been highly customized to counter any tough terrain, and it looks quite badass.

The image of this Ford Endeavour has been uploaded by an Instagram page- Stay Tuned India. This SUV is owned by Mr Sooraj Rm and the custom job has been done by Autobacs. The Ford Endeavour you see here employs a lot of aftermarket customization. Now, talking about the modifications, it gets Profender Mono Tube 2.5 Subtank with 15-step adjustments up front and Hot Bits Mono Tune 2.5 Subtank with 19-step adjustment at the rear. It also gets Ironman 4X4 coil springs, SUN 4X4 upper arm, SUN 4X4 drop kit, optional 4WD front shock spacers and unicorn rear shock spacers. The side profile of the Ford SUV gets 20-inch fuel assault off-road rims, which are wrapped with 33X12.50X20 Gladiator X comp M/T tyres. It employs Raptor X series body kit.

The front fascia of the SUV features Rhino bonnet scoops, MCC off-road snorkel, ARB 4X4 GME UHF heavy duty antenna. The stock LED headlamps are replaced by aftermarket projector headlights with colour changeable projectors. Moreover, it also gets aftermarket rear fog lights, F-series roof lamps, cube lights and Bushwacker Fender. These are all the modification done to this Ford Endeavour. The overall cost of all the customizations is not known, but it seems to be quite expensive. The mechanical specs of this Ford Endeavour are not known. The regular model of the SUV is powered by a 2.0-litre diesel mill, which develops power and torque outputs of 168 Bhp and 420 Nm. The engine comes paired with a 10-speed AT.
